We’re delighted to announce that Marienella Phillips will be with us again in January to explore what it means to be a singing actor, sharing techniques and strategies required improve our singing from a musical, dramatic, and imaginative viewpoint.

This relaxed one-day course will focus on studying singing from an actor's perspective, linking vocal technique with truthful storytelling. Under the guidance of Marienella, participants will present a song of their choice to a friendly and supportive audience of their peers.

Marienella Phillips is a British-Filipino mezzo-soprano working across theatre, musical theatre, and opera. With a passion for performing nurtured early on, she earned both a Bachelor's and Master's degree in Music from the University of Bristol, before continuing her training at the Royal Welsh College of Music & Drama. She has since performed with some of the UK’s leading companies—including the Royal Shakespeare Company, Donmar Warehouse, and Welsh National Opera—toured nationally, and appeared in the West End.

Recent credits include: Hamlet: Hail to the Thief, Love’s Labour's Lost (RSC), Henry V (Donmar Warehouse & NT Live), To Henry With Love (Princess Theatre Burnham-on-Sea), Ashes (Princess Theatre Burnham-on-Sea), The King & I (West End / UK & Ireland Tour), A Christmas Carol (The Lowry / Hope Mill Theatre), The Fabulist (Charing Cross Theatre)

Marienella is also official anthem singer for the Rugby Football Union and other large sporting events in the UK having sung the English and Welsh National Anthems at various stadiums including Twickenham for the Six Nations: England vs Ireland 2024, Wembley for the Women's FA Cup 2024: Manchester UTD vs Tottenham, and Ashton Gate for the Red Roses vs Wales 2022. Winner of the Adelina Patti and Dolan Evans Prizes 2019 and Sir Ian Stoutzker Prize Finalist 2021 (RWCMD).
